Q: What exactly counts as a Java Character?
Java identifies characters through UTF-16 encoding, treating every Unicode code point as a meaningful unit in source files, strings, and system properties. These characters include letters, digits, punctuation—even symbolic ones—when properly defined and handled.
Q: Can poor character use cause real issues?
Yes. Unintentional encoding mismatches or invalid sequences can break validation, trigger exceptions, or expose vulnerabilities—especially in data-heavy applications. Consistent, standards-aligned usage avoids these pitfalls.
Q: Do Java Characters affect app performance?
Indirectly. Efficient character encoding reduces memory footprint and speeds up string manipulation—key factors in mobile and cloud-native apps where responsiveness matters.
